3D Printing in Oral Surgery
To improve the field of dental surgery, you can check out the subtopic of 3D printing in dental surgery. This ingenious technology has the prospective to change the way dental surgeons run and treat clients. Below are 4 vital methods which 3D printing is shaping the field:
- ** Customized Surgical Guides **: 3D printing enables the development of very precise and patient-specific surgical guides, boosting the precision and performance of treatments.
- ** Implant Prosthetics **: With 3D printing, dental surgeons can create customized implant prosthetics that completely fit a person's special composition, resulting in better end results and person contentment.
- ** Bone Grafting **: 3D printing enables the manufacturing of patient-specific bone grafts, decreasing the demand for typical grafting methods and improving recovery and healing time.
- ** Education and learning and Training **: 3D printing can be made use of to produce practical medical models for instructional objectives, enabling oral specialists to exercise complicated treatments prior to executing them on people.
With its prospective to boost accuracy, modification, and training, 3D printing is an exciting advancement in the field of dental surgery.
